A practical event flow
A company winter event often works best when it has a clear structure. For example:
- Welcome moment with drinks
- Business segment such as a speech, update or presentation
- Social transition into a drink or informal networking moment
- Shared dining experience to close the event
This kind of structure gives the event momentum. It also helps balance business objectives with celebration.
Tailored setups make the difference
No two companies organize the same kind of event. Some want a sleek, structured format with presentation support. Others prefer a relaxed social gathering. The most effective approach is to tailor the setup to the event goal.
De Heeren van Montfoort offers different setup possibilities for business gatherings, including:
- Theater
- Cabaret
- Boardroom
- Borrel
That flexibility matters because room design influences energy. A presentation format requires focus and visibility. A networking setup should encourage movement and conversation. A festive dinner asks for comfort, rhythm and atmosphere.
What to consider when planning your setup
When shaping an Office to Winter Festival event at your company site, think about:
- The purpose of the gathering
- The number of guests
- The balance between formal and informal moments
- The technical needs for speeches or presentations
- The desired atmosphere for the final part of the event
A clear setup helps everything else fall into place.

Practical tips for planning your Office to Winter Festival event
If you want to turn your company site into a festive year-end venue, these tips can help.
Define the purpose first
Before thinking about food or styling, decide what the event must achieve.
Ask:
- Is this mainly a staff celebration?
- Is it also meant for clients or partners?
- Does it include a formal business moment?
- Should the evening end with dinner or a networking drink?
Build the event in phases
A clear sequence creates calm and momentum. Consider structuring the event as:
- Arrival and welcome
- Formal moment
- Transition to drinks
- Dining or social close
Match the setup to the energy you want
Choose a layout that supports the behavior you want from guests. A boardroom style is very different from a borrel setup, and each creates a different experience.
Plan for guest comfort
Good hospitality is practical. Think about flow, pacing and timing. Guests should know where to go, when things begin and how the event progresses.
Keep room for customization
The best events rarely fit a fixed template. Tailored choices in menu, planning and styling help create an event that feels intentional rather than generic.
